**Mgmt Meeting Minutes — Retiring the Brightline Range**

Quick recap for sales leads at Fenholt Supplies: we agreed to retire the Brightline fixture range by year-end. Remaining stock moves to clearance pricing next month, and accounts on standing orders get migrated to the Lumetta range. Trade-in incentives were approved in principle. The confidential note on next steps sits just below.

board note of bajof-bajeg: The pricing group signed off on a budget of $13.4 million for Project Sildor. The renewal with Lamixek Holdings closes at $48.9 million a year, 49 percent above the last contract.

## Deployment — Ledgerline CSV Import Wizard

The wizard ships as a sidecar to the main Ledgerline app and deploys via the standard pipeline. Staging gets every merge; production releases are cut Thursdays after the sync. Upload limits and chunk sizes are environment-specific, so confirm them before rollout. Current production settings are as follows.

config for kafof-bawef:
holath:
  log_level: debug
  metrics_host: metrics.holath.qorvelsys.internal
  pin: 2191
  pool_size: 32

For the weekly sync: the Payvern integration suite has been flaking at roughly 8% over the past two sprints, mostly in the refund-reconciliation tests. Root cause appears to be shared fixture state in the test database — parallel runs occasionally read each other's ledger rows. Short-term mitigation is serializing the refund tests; the longer fix is per-run schema isolation, which Tomas is prototyping. To reproduce locally, run the suite against the shared flake-repro database using the connection string below.

database URL for tajog-bajeg: mysql://soreth_svc:OzsCjhu@db-6997.nelvrostack.internal:5432/kelax

Facilities ticket — Halewick Tower, night shift.

Issue: support team reporting east stairwell reader rejecting badges after midnight. Reader was reset this morning; firmware updated. Overnight crew should now badge as normal. If the reader fails again, use the manual keypad by the fire door — do not prop the door. Log any further failures with the time and badge name. Temporary keypad code for the fallback door is below.

door code, tajeg-fawip: bdg-K-62